The resolution proposes to officially rename the Gulf of Mexico as the "Gulf of America" and mandates that all state agencies in Arkansas use this new terminology in their official communications, including maps, documents, and educational materials. The rationale behind this change emphasizes the Gulf's significance to the economic, environmental, and cultural landscape of the United States, particularly highlighting its role in energy production, trade, and tourism. The resolution aims to reinforce the patriotic values of Arkansas and acknowledge the contributions of American industries and workers associated with the Gulf.

Additionally, the resolution encourages the United States government and other states to adopt the term "Gulf of America" to recognize the importance of this body of water to the nation. It directs state agencies to update their materials accordingly and ensures that the resolution is communicated to relevant authorities for prompt implementation.
